374 MDG Change of Command

U.S. Air Force Col. Richard McElhaney, 374th Airlift Wing commander, presents the Legion of Merit to Col. Gregory Richert, 374th Medical Group outgoing commander, during the 374 MDG change of command ceremony at Yokota Air Base, Japan, June 23, 2025. The 374 MDG ensures medical readiness of 374 AW, 5th Air Force and U.S. Forces Japan. The group maintains 64 war reserve material projects, including the U.S. Air Force's largest Patient Movement Item inventory, deploys Expeditionary Medical Support for global contingency operations, operates a 15-bed facility expandable to 115 beds and provides health care, including occupational health, preventive medicine and environmental protection to more than 11,000 personnel.
